Intratumorally-Administered Topotecan Using Convection-Enhanced Delivery in Patients With Grade III/ IV Glioma

Terminated EARLY_PHASE1 Last updated 25 May 2023
What this trial tests

EARLY_PHASE1 trial testing Topotecan in Glioma of Brain in 3 participants. Terminated before completion.

Sponsor's own description

The purpose of this study is to determine if treatment with Topotecan by an alternative method, delivering topotecan directly into brain tumors, is safe and well tolerated.
